MPEG / .MPG / .DAT MPEG is the abbreviation of Motion Picture Experts Group. .Such formats include MPEG-1, MPEG-2 and MPEG-4, including a variety of video formats. .MPEG-1 is believed to have the most contact with us, because now it is being widely used in the production of VCD and some video clips to download the network application above, most of the VCD format is compressed with MPEG1 (burning software automatically .MPEG1 conversion. DAT format), use MPEG-1 compression algorithm, you can put a 120-minute long film compressed to about 1.2 GB size. .MPEG-2 is used in DVD production, while the number of HDTV (high definition television) and a number of demanding video editing, processing the above there are a considerable number of applications. .Using the MPEG-2 compression algorithm compression of a 120-minute long film can be compressed to 5-8 GB in size (MPEG2 image quality MPEG-1 and its incomparable). .*. AVI AVI, Audio Video Interleaved (Audio Video Interleaved) abbreviation. .This AVI video format released by Microsoft in the video field has been in existence for a few years. .AVI format called convenience, image quality is good, but the drawback is the file size is too large *. ASF ASF (Advanced Streaming format Advanced Streaming Format). .ASF is a MICROSOFT Real player in order, and now developed a competition can watch videos online file compression format. .ASF uses MPEG4 compression algorithm, compression ratio and image quality is very good. .Because ASF is an online real-time viewing of the video "streaming" format exists, so it's almost point image quality than VCD is not surprising, but higher than with a video "streaming" format better RAM format. .*. WMV encoding an independent real-time communication in the Internet standards for multimedia technology, Microsoft hopes to replace with its technical standards like QuickTime, and WAV, AVI file extensions like. .The main advantage of WMV: scalable media types, local or network playback, scalable media types, stream prioritization, multiple language support, scalability and so on. .*.
